当前位置:教程列表 > 教程信息

防死机卫士--CrashGuardDeluxe

关键字:
来源:8844软件服务 pqspqs创建于 2006-12-28 23:57 阅读 197次   网友评论 0


 ? 谁的计算机没有过死机的经历?就连比尔在正式推出号称“永不死机”的Windows 98时也当场遭遇到死机的难堪。在我们大家常用的Windows 9X操作系统中,死机则是家常便饭了,要是你早上8点上班的时候开机,到了下班的时候,死机次数小于3次则算是非常幸运的了。当屏幕上出现那个“该程序执行了非法指令,即将被关闭”的对话框时,你是不是还有正在编辑的文档没有存盘?或者是辛苦半天编写的程序没有保存呢?也许就是这个小小的对话框,会让你一天的辛勤劳动付之东流。而Symantec公司出品的CrashGuard Deluxe就是一个称职的防死机卫士,它可以运行在后台,当程序出现崩溃迹象之前对其进行拦截,因此你能够趁此机会把那些还没有存盘的文件保存起来,将损失减小到最低程度。

   安装CrashGuard Deluxe非常简单,你可以采用一路回车法轻松将其搞定,不过在安装完毕之后建议立即重新启动计算机。当计算机重新启动之后,你会发现在系统图标栏中多出了一个图标(附图1),

哈哈,这就是CrashGuard Deluxe已经悄悄的驻留在后台为你服务了。所以它的自动运行方式还是非常体贴我们这些懒人或者是记性不好的玩家。

   一、界面与功能

  使用CrashGuard Deluxe之前,你需要对其进行一番设置工作来让它有针对性的进行防护。此时双击右下角系统图标栏的图标,将会看见CrashGuard Deluxe的主界面(附图2)。

  在这个窗口中,可以看见左边有四个圆形的3D功能按钮,将鼠标移动到按键上之后,右边的区域中还会有相应的功能介绍,点击这些能够激活相应的功能,在此先将这些功能简单介绍一下。

   【CrashGuard】激活CrashGuard Deluxe附带的CrashGuard 3.0主程序,这将在下文详细介绍,现在就不多说了。

   【System Check】对系统进行一个全面的检测,还能够将查找到的错误即时进行修复。

   点击这个按键之后,会看见另外一个窗口(附图3),

  其中上面的列表选项区域中一共附带有13项和系统相关的检测诊断选项,比如内存病毒检测、硬盘检测、注册表检测、无效的快捷方式检测、硬盘优化等等,基本上涵盖了所有和系统稳定性有重要关联的项目 诩觳庵翱梢允褂檬蟊暝诟囱】蛑械闳⌒枰觳獾南钅浚耸贝蠹铱梢愿葑约旱男枰唇醒≡瘢缒阋丫沧傲薔orton AntiVirus 2000,那么有关病毒检测的项目就可以忽略,但是建议大家对于其它的选项不要轻易的取消。

   完成了检测项目的选择之后,按下右边的“Start”按钮,CrashGuard Deluxe就会着手对系统进行一个全面细致的检查工作。如图4所示,还可以调整下部的优先级来设置检测的速度(附图4)。

  一般将滑动块拖拽到最右边的“High”时系统会提供更多的资源用于检测,如果想在检测的同时进行其它的操作,就要把滑块设置为“Low”级别。

   全部的检测完成后,还有一个窗口显示当前系统中存在的问题(附图5)。

  值得一提的是,CrashGuard Deluxe虽然是一个防死机的工具,不过它在系统检测方面的功能还是非常强大的。像笔者在平时非常注意系统的维护,超级兔仔、SystemMedician这类系统维护工具用的不少,不过在CrashGuard Deluxe检测之后还是查找出来上百个错误!可见功能的强大,这大概也借用了Norton Utilities 2000一些精髓的缘故吧。发现这些问题之后,当然是要想办法修复了,那么最简单的解决之道就是按下右边的“Fix All”来让CrashGuard Deluxe自动进行修复。

   【System Guide】一些和系统相关的介绍。

   激活这个功能之后,看见的是图6所示的窗口(附图6)。

  这个窗口看起来非常简单,上部的“About”是关于CrashGuard Deluxe的一些版权信息、操作系统、CPU、内存与可用系统资源的介绍;而点击了下部的“Glossary”按钮之后,你会发现有一个帮助文档窗口弹出,其中有“A”至“Z”的字母索引,选中一个之后能够查看到与此有关的计算机名词介绍。虽然这些都是英文的,但是非常简单,从中你能够知晓许多有用的信息,可以说这是一本小型的计算机专业词典了。

   【Norton Web Services】可以直接与Symantec公司的站点相连接,进行在线升级或者是获得其它相关的信息。

   细心的朋友还会注意到在这个主界面的下部还有四个按钮,其中“Help”和“Exit”的含义想必不用再费口舌了吧,那么我们再来看看另外两个按钮有什么用途。

   【Log Book】记录CrashGuard Deluxe的运行日志,以便日后的查找使用。

   按下这个按键后,可以看见所有CrashGuard Deluxe运行的情况记录,比如刚才我们对系统进行了一次全面的检测与修复工作,那么在此就能够查找到一共发现了多少个文件有错误、每个文件检测到有错误的时间、是否被修复、修复之后能不能取消等信息(附图7)。

  所以呢,你要是在刚才采用“Fix All”来自动修复全部的错误后,发现有些程序不能正常使用,也可以在此选中相应的文件并点击右边的“Undo”键来对其进行恢复操作,这下你在修复错误的时候应该没有后顾之忧了吧。

   【Settings】对CrashGuard Deluxe进行一些设置。

   在设置窗口中有六个标签(附图8)。

  其中“System Check”是你定义的系统检测模式;“Auto Check”是CrashGuard Deluxe默认的系统检测模式,它们的区别在于前者可以根据需要进行有目的性的选择,而后者是将13种检测功能全部进行检测。“Log Book”标签下可以设置存放日志的期限,要是你觉得太多的话也能够在此直接删除它们;“Internet”是设定连接到Symantec站点时候所使用的拨号连接、用户名与口令等与网络相关的选项;“CrashGuarD”标签下的内容我们也会在后文中介绍,在此就不多说了;“Norton Web Services”设置的内容也是与Symantec公司站点相关的,比如自动升级所产生的临时文件多长时间删除、登录到站点所使用的用户名与口令等。

   看完上文之后,你应该对CrashGuard Deluxe的界面有了一个基本的认识吧。不过也许你会觉得有些奇怪:这只是它关于系统检测和修复方面的功能,那么防死机的功能又在何处呢?不用着急,现在我们就来看看大家最为关注的防死机功能啦。

   二、防死机核心CrashGuard

  在上面介绍的CrashGuard Deluxe主窗口中直接点击“CrashGuard”按钮,或者是右击系统栏图标并选择“Open”之后,你就会看见这个防死机卫士的核心程序---CrashGuard了(附图9)。看看它的界面,作成了一面盾牌的形状,很像古代战争中那些步卒手中拿着的玩意吧。(什么?你想到了110和警察?我真是!^&#%*#!&^%……) 在这面盾牌上也有四个按钮,也分别对应着不同的功能,为了大家使用起来方便,还是先介绍一下它们吧。

   【Anti-Freeze】在CrashGuard Deluxe中,如果有些正在运行的程序可能会导致系统失去响应,那么这些程序就被称之为Freeze,而这个功能就是让这些程序恢复响应的能力。

   试着按下这个按键,你会看见如图10所示的窗口(附图10),

  其中列表显示的就是当前系统中所有正在运行的程序。比如有一个名为“中文之星2.5”的程序失去响应的话,你可以先选中它然后点击右边的“Unfreeze”按钮,这样多半能够将这个程序“救活”。不过世上没有万能药,如果某个程序调用了KERNEL32.DLL之类的Windows系统内核文件,那么这颗“救命药”也会失效的,此时只有一个解决的办法,就是选中它并按下“Kill Task”将其从任务列表中删除,这样好歹还能防止系统完全失去响应。幸运的是,在Windows中真正调用到系统内核文件的程序还不是很多,所以通常这个功能都是有效的。

   【Settings】关于CrashGuard的设置选项。

   在这个设置选项里,首先能够选择CrashGuard针对32位程序还是16位程序进行监测。随着32位Windows操作系统的普及,Windows 3.1已经逐渐淡出江湖了,而16位的应用程序也是凤毛麟角,不过为了安全起见,还是两者都选中为妙。另外还有一个选项是用来设定按下“Ctrl+Alt+Del”的组合按键之后,CrashGuard是否参与到工作中。如果选中的话,再按下这三个组合按键后会发现界面有所改变,也就是多出了一个“Anti-Freeze”按钮,因此只要CrashGuard Deluxe运行在后台,你也可以通过这种方式来使一个失去响应的程序继续正常工作(附图11)。

   在下部还有一个“Advanced”按键,相信那些高手们都不会错过这个高级设置功能的。点击它之后可分别对32位和16位应用程序的监测进行设定。比如在对32位应用程序设置的时候,可以选择数据溢出、堆栈检查、数据非法操作、非法指令等内容进行设置(附图12)。

  在经过这里的设置之后,CrashGuard的防护能力将更为强悍。像笔者以前在使用Delphi编程的时候,经常会遇到由于数据溢出而导致Delphi程序关闭的情况,而现在选择了针对数据溢出进行监测之后,一旦再遇到这类情况,CrashGuard会预先进行拦截让你中止操作,从而保证了程序的正常运行。

   【Log Book】和上面介绍的一样,也是记录日志的。不过这里记录的就是CrashGuard发现错误之后拦截的内容,在此也不详述了。

   【Help】一些关于CrashGuard的帮助文档,有兴趣的朋友可以自己研究一下,不过你的英文要有一定的水准才行呀,呵呵!

   当CrashGuard Deluxe运行之后,CrashGuard这个防死机卫士就会自动对当前系统中所有正在运行的程序进行即时的监测,如果有意外的出错情况,它会自动对其进行拦截。如果你发现有程序失去响应之后,就可以按下“Ctrl+Alt+Del”组合按键之后选择没有响应的程序并对其进行恢复即可。所以,它的使用还是非常简单的吧!

   介绍完CrashGuard Deluxe之后,你是否也想试试这个功能强大的防死机卫士呢?也许你怕安装了这样的一个东东之后会影响系统的运行速度吧,那么笔者要告诉你,在测试使用PIII 667、Kingmax 128M内存、酷鱼II 20G的计算机上,它只占用了3%的系统资源,这比打开一个IE窗口所占用的资源还要少,而在运行包括大型游戏在内的其它程序中都感觉不到机器运行效率的降低,所以花上一点点资源来换取系统的稳定性是非常值得的。



打印』 『收藏』 『导出Word
发表评论:共有 0 评论 查看全部评论
验证码:       
关键字:  

学软件相关文章
  
有问必答相关问题
  
相关下载